PLACEMENT AND WEATHER CONFIGURATION NOTE: For clean, mess-free indoor deployment over carpets, hardwood, or luxury retail tile, utilize the "No Drainage" configuration. For outdoor open plazas, exposed decks, or garden pathways, ensure the "Pre-Drilled" drainage option is selected to allow automated water runoff, protecting your roots from saturation and preventing freeze-expansion damage to the unibody structure during harsh winter storms.


Technical Specifications & Sizing Matrix

Model Variant / SKU Outer Size (L × W × H) Planting Opening (L × W) Soil Capacity Net Weight
69050.C 16 × 16 × 42 in 13.25 × 13.25 in
69050.24 (This Model) 24 × 16 × 42 in 21.25 × 13.25 in
69050.36 36 × 16 × 42 in 33.25 × 13.25 in 90 gal 50.7 lb
69050.48 48 × 16 × 42 in 45.25 × 13.25 in 120 gal 65 lb
69050.60 60 × 16 × 42 in 57.25 × 13.25 in
69050.72 72 × 16 × 42 in 69 × 13.25 in

What varieties of plants grow best inside this compact 24-inch model?

The 24-inch length core features a highly functional 21.25" x 13.25" planting opening that easily handles substantial root networks. It pairs beautifully with elegant vertical accents like compact palms, ornamental grasses, or structured topiary boxwoods. For a softer look, it also works wonderfully with cascading indoor pothos, snake plants, or dramatic split-leaf philodendrons.

Will the custom automotive paint finish bubble or crack in extreme winter freezes?

No. Jay Scotts implements a premium automotive liquid coating system that chemically bonds straight into the raw fiberglass composite shell. The finish effortlessly tolerates severe freeze-thaw cycles and boiling summer heat waves without bubbling, cracking, or turning yellow. For outdoor environments, ensure you select the "Pre-Drilled" drainage variation so rainwater drains instantly rather than forming expanding ice blocks inside the basin core.
